Ghostwriting is a popular and increasingly in-demand service that allows individuals and businesses to outsource their writing needs. Whether you're an entrepreneur looking to create blog posts, a thought leader looking to write a book, or a busy executive looking to write speeches and presentations, ghostwriting can help you achieve your goals. But before you hire a professional ghostwriter , it's important to understand the basics of how the process works. The first step in working with a ghostwriter is to find the right one for your project. This can be done by searching online for ghostwriting services, asking for referrals from friends and colleagues, or reaching out to professional writing organizations. When you find a ghostwriter that you're interested in working with, be sure to ask for samples of their work, as well as their rates and availability.
